Chroma Technology Reduces Carbon Footprint with New Solar Project

Feb 11 2022

Bellows Falls, VT- Chroma Technology is taking a critical step in reducing its carbon footprint with a new solar project just 20 minutes south of our Bellows Falls, Vermont manufacturing facility. Chroma partnered with Green Lantern Solar to develop a solar array that will produce approximately 950,000 kWh per year of clean, solar power. We estimate that this will reduce our carbon footprint by approximately 800,000 pounds of CO2 per year; roughly the equivalent of removing 148 cars from Vermont's roads.

In addition to contributing to a greener environment, this new solar array will reduce our energy costs and benefitted several local business during its development and construction. This project is part of Chroma's ongoing efforts to reduce our energy consumption and honor our commitment to conduct our business in a socially responsible and environmentally sustainable way.

 

About Chroma Technology

Founded in 1991 as a 100% employee-owned company and now a B Corporation, Chroma Technology is a leading manufacturer and OEM supplier of high performance optical filters used in a wide range of applications including health care, biomedical research, remote sensing, machine vision, and aerospace. Chroma offers an extensive selection of catalogue products as well as custom solutions tailored to our customers’ specific needs.

About Green Lantern Solar

Green Lantern Solar is based in New England with offices in ME, MA and VT and delivers top-quality, full-service solar solutions to resorts, schools, towns, businesses and government entities. Over the past ten years Green Lantern Solar has constructed, developed and managed nearly 100 commercial and utility-scale projects offsetting roughly 50 million pounds of CO2 emissions while saving our partners $1.5 million in energy costs annually.
